WebAug 21, 2024 · Chipsets are important to a motherboard's compatibility. A chipset used to be a collection of chips on a motherboard. The chipset served as a middleman between the CPU and other components. The chipset on a motherboard determined the compatibility to additional components. Yes, but not in a manner that’s as easy to understand as a better GPU, RAM, etc. Contrary to how things were back in the … suzuki rm 125cc 2008WebMar 27, 2024 · Motherboards With More Than Four RAM Slots. Most motherboards have up to four slots, but some double that number. If you have a motherboard with eight slots, your computer might support triple-channel or quad-channel memory support. Similar RAM installation order applies here as with four-slot motherboards. suzuki rm 125 cdi box
